Spread the wordOn the evidence of what Iga Swiatek showed across the first four rounds, it never truly felt like she would complete the career Grand Slam at this year’s Australian Open. Swiatek’s bid for the clean sweep was ended by Elena Rybakina in the Melbourne quarter-finals, with the Kazakh fifth seed triumphing 7-5 6-1. And former Wimbledon champion Rybakina, known for her powerful game from the baseline, ruthlessly took advantage. It’s never been so flawless for me playing on these courts, as they are fast,” second seed Swiatek said. Rybakina immediately took control of the second set, her groundstrokes flying through the court, and Swiatek could do little to halt her momentum.
